Each trial starts with a cross for 500ms, then there is a stimulus composed of two images presented one after another for 500ms each, and then the subject has 2s to make a decision. After that, there are "irrelevant" (for this correct/incorrect analysis) stimuli: the subject is asked to rate its confidence by pressing a button 1-4 within 2s, then there is a random delay between 2.5-3s, then the subject sees a feedback stimulus about that decision for 2s, is asked to make a second decision within other 2s, and finally there is another random delay of 2.5-3s. It would be great to model these other stimuli as well, as they are related to the main decision-making process. How can I model multiple ones at once? I have stim_files saying which trials are low vs. high confident, or in which trials the second decision is different from the first one.
